Etna Rosato DOC 2023 (750 ml.) Tenute Mannino

Etna Rosato by Tenute Mannino is a pure Nerello Mascalese. Grapes harvested from 30-50 year old vines located on the slopes of the volcano in Contrada Bragaseggi on the northern side of Etna, at an altitude of 600 m.a.s.l.. Freshness and minerality, elegance and great drinkability are the characteristics of a wine obtained from the prince variety of Etna. It has a pale pink color with pleasant coral shades and on the nose it releases delicate floral notes but also small red fruits and wild strawberries. The taste is fresh, savory and mineral, with a fairly long finish that recalls the sip. Less than 2,000 bottles produced. A rosé wine with great versatility in pairings, ideal with Mediterranean dishes, vegetables or fish soups. Try it with a pasta based on swordfish and bottarga.

The manor estate, Tenuta del Gelso, has been an extraordinary and innovative winemaking laboratory since the early 19th century. From here, from the Catania plain, Baron Franz Mannino made his wine known in Europe and North America, also obtaining prestigious awards at various universal exhibitions. During the grape harvest, the palmento, one of the oldest in the area, was the site of a real family celebration in which all the inhabitants of the House took part: from joyful children to friends and neighbors who flocked to Tenuta del Gelso to immerse themselves in a riot of smells, lights and colors until late at night. Giuseppe Mannino has given new life to the family business and to the Etna Doc denomination, building an active and dynamic business reality. Now in its sixth generation, his son Giorgio is now leading a solid and established winemaking and agricultural business reality. A company that is the guardian of ancient traditions, but also capable of looking to the future and ahead of its time. The living rooms of the Villa still echo the conversations held by its inhabitants with Giovanni Verga or Ettore Majorana, tangible evidence of the reputation of Tenute Mannino as a family of patrons.
